Xiaomi launches new mid-range phone with large battery and 120Hz AMOLED display

The Redmi Note 17 Pro has been launched in the global market alongside the other three phones of the series. It has a large 8,340mAh battery, and Xiaomi claims that it can offer over 2 days of runtime. There’s a 6.83-inch AMOLED display, and the phone has support for 67W fast charging.

Xiaomi has launched a total of four phones in the global market, and the Redmi Note 17 Pro is one of them. This is a 5G mid-range phone that's powered by a not-so-new Qualcomm SoC, the Snapdragon 6s Gen 4.

It's a mid-range SoC from 2025 that's paired with up to 12GB of LPDDR4X RAM and 512GB of UFS 3.1 storage. The mid-range phone has a 6.83-inch display on the front, and it's an AMOLED panel that sports a 2772x1280 pixels resolution and 120Hz refresh rate.

This display has a peak brightness rating of 3,500 nits, but unlike the Pro Max model, there's no support for Dolby Vision or HDR10+. It's protected by Gorilla Glass Victus 2, and there are multiple features to ensure a comfortable viewing experience, including the hardware-level TÜV Rheinland Low Blue Light tech.

The Redmi Note 17 Pro 5G has an 8,340mAh battery in the EU, and Xiaomi says that it allows the phone to offer over 2 days of runtime. There's support for 67W fast charging, and users can take advantage of the relatively large battery to charge other devices through the 22.5W reverse charging support (60W Beats 20cm type-C cable curr. $11.99 on Amazon).

On the back, the phone has a 50MP primary camera with OIS, and it's paired with an 8MP ultrawide. The front sports a 16MP selfie shooter, and there are multiple AI-enhanced camera features.

Other notable aspects of the Redmi Note 17 Pro include a dual-speaker setup with Dolby Atmos, IP66/IP68 ratings, and availability in three colors. In the EU, the configuration with 8GB of RAM and 256GB of storage is retailing for €479.90, which isn't an attractive price for a mid-range phone with a year-old SoC. However, the current DRAM market conditions have impacted all manufacturers, and Xiaomi isn't an exception.
